    Beauty, buddhas & baci in Luang Prabang

    February 6, 2019 in Laos ⋅ ☀️ 26 °C

    Our last stop before heading “home” to Thailand was Luang Prabang in Laos, another UNESCO World Heritage Centre on our South East Asian tour. We took a riverboat down the mighty Mekong, saw caves littered with age-old Buddha statues, frolicked in 2 beautiful waterfalls, avoided buying scorpion-infused Lao whisky, and were recipients of blessings at a Baci ceremony, a traditional Lao ceremony led by family elders to bring your spirits back together, for luck and strength... oh, and of course, enjoyed a few temples! Luang Prabang is a lovely town absolutely packed with tourists like us, all doing the same things... I would return here, but would spend more time exploring other parts of the country next time.Read more
